Product Description:

The part number 8LVA33.R0021D200-0 works as a synchronous servo motor by B&R Automation for synchronously controlling the motion of its shaft. The company delivers efficient solutions to meet the high standards of industrial automation.

This 8LVA33.R0021D200-0 servo motor works with a nominal current of 7.3 amperes which aids in supporting reliable operation within its intended load range. The nominal torque is 2.5 Newton-meters which functions by indicating its suitability for mid-level mechanical loads. In contrast the nominal speed is specified at 2100 revolutions per minute by allowing steady and stable shaft rotation during motion tasks. Peak current is rated at 7.9 amperes and slightly above the nominal value which provides a small buffer during load variations. It has a voltage need of 57 volts for turning on the unit. It meets the exceptional class of IP54 protection by making it resistant to limited dust and splashes of water from any direction. The motor includes a 24-volt DC brake system with a holding torque of 3.2 Newton-meters which is useful in positioning or vertical motion systems where shaft locking is necessary.

The 8LVA33.R0021D200-0 servo motor insulation system follows Class F standards meaning it can follow operational temperatures up to 155°C and it is rated for ambient conditions up to 40°C maximum. There is no integrated coolant system inside it which shows the unit is intended for air-cooled installations or environments where external cooling is unnecessary. The unit carries certification marks from CE and UL by verifying it meets proper electrical and safety standards. The maximum torque reaches 2.8 Newton-meters which aids in delivering short bursts of additional force when mechanical resistance increases.
